How random number generators ensure fair play
At the core of every legitimate online casino, a Random Number Generator (RNG) acts as the digital equivalent of a shuffled deck or spinning wheel, constantly producing unpredictable results. This algorithm ensures that each card dealt or slot reel stopped is independent of the previous outcome, eliminating any pattern or player interference. Independent testing agencies audit these RNGs to verify their outputs are statistically random, meaning the house edge is built into the game’s math, not the software’s bias. Without this process, you could not trust that a 100-to-1 jackpot hit was a genuine fluke rather than a software glitch.

Understanding wagering requirements before claiming bonuses
Before accepting any bonus, you must decode its wagering requirements structure, as this directly dictates your real withdrawal potential. Always calculate the total playthrough amount—typically a multiple of the bonus or bonus-plus-deposit—and assess whether your typical bet sizes and game selection can efficiently clear it without depleting your bankroll. A 35x requirement on a $100 bonus means wagering $3,500 before any cashout. Ignoring these figures often locks funds into an unrealistic chase.
- Identify if the requirement applies to bonus funds only or to deposit plus bonus, as this doubles the target sum.
- Check game contribution percentages: slots usually count 100%, but table games may only count 10–20%.
- Verify the maximum bet allowed while wagering—exceeding it voids the bonus and winnings.
Choosing games with the best return-to-player percentages
Prioritize slots with an RTP of 96% or higher to maximize potential long-term value. High-RTP game selection directly reduces the mathematical house edge against your bankroll. Table games like blackjack often offer superior percentages, especially with optimal strategy. Video poker variants, such as Jacks or Better, can exceed 99% when played correctly. Always verify the published RTP for the specific variant you choose, as variations between titles significantly impact your expected return.

How long do withdrawals usually take?
Withdrawal times at online casinos vary significantly based on the method chosen. E-wallets like PayPal or Skrill typically process withdrawals within 24 hours, while debit cards can take 3–5 business days. Bank transfers are often the slowest, sometimes requiring up to a week. The casino’s internal review period, which covers identity verification, also adds time, usually 24–48 hours for first-time withdrawals. E-wallet withdrawals offer the fastest processing for beginners seeking quick access to funds.
